The National Day of Remembrance for Victims of German Nazi Concentration and Extermination Camps was commemorated in Sheffield, UK. Under the honorary patronage of the Institute of National Remembrance, Green Light - Family Support organised a special event featuring a popular science conference and the exhibition Women in KL Auschwitz. Representing IPN, Dr Hab. Bogusław Wójcik delivered a lecture on the importance of education and preserving historical truth, highlighting innovative educational initiatives aimed at younger generations. The event brought together local community leaders, educators, descendants of survivors, and representatives of Polish diplomatic services to honour the victims and safeguard the memory of their experiences.
